Native Hawaiian vs Honduran Family Households with Children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 331,771,258 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Native Hawaiians and percentage of family households with children in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.013 and weighted average of 27.4%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 357,499,816 people shows a poor negative correlation between the proportion of Hondurans and percentage of family households with children in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.163 and weighted average of 28.5%, a difference of 4.1%.
